Cut the top off 2 liter bottles & put in cheesy plastic flowers for centerpieces. Make a cheese & cracker tray, but instead of pieces of cheese, set the cans of spray cheese on the tray. If you can – go to Goodwill or something & get a barcolounger-type chair to put in the yard. If you can get a toilet to put in the yard, that would be good to put ice & sodas/beer in. Sting up the x-mas lights and put a plastic santa in the yard. Instead of good cookies & pastries – set out trays of twinkies, ding dongs & ho hos. Have buckets of KFC out. If you are having a costume contest – give out lottery tickets for prizes. Make sure you have some really twangy country music playing!
